Transaction 73c8928913688442b1949a2e0bad9d3b02b6404ed487def46d0de0f0812f7248
1 Input
1 Output
-
73c8928913688442b1949a2e0bad9d3b02b6404ed487def46d0de0f0812f7248:0
- value
- 407588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17d31aae5f0d9af575c1a6ff837ef220824389a8 OP_EQUAL
- address
- 33rzMjYrgiyWvfdM4cyMAokXBXSvYFRPbj